Transaction e2a53219942b4a4e6ebffb49d0a8e54dbaac5ce199a1a31f79a1be83f3a455e8

28 Input
1 Outputs
  • e2a53219942b4a4e6ebffb49d0a8e54dbaac5ce199a1a31f79a1be83f3a455e8:0
  • value  2037112416
    address  3Bmk4VG6x5XVa1Mz5HoSaRw5H5xLUxxsAa